Output 143fd109b3f7e9e5ff8f7e1a65546f0101fd2552e914ce10498c1dcbfef05133:0

value
1659009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03412c5261e7bcc8275d1aa5b2cce9ec5df6021e OP_EQUAL
address
31zE2RmXj65bykgwzqMf9Z5NRxadqpU4cH
transaction
143fd109b3f7e9e5ff8f7e1a65546f0101fd2552e914ce10498c1dcbfef05133
spent
true